About the Role
As our dedicated Inspections Officer , you will play an important role in supporting our Property Management team and ensuring our landlords and tenants receive exceptional service.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Conducting routine property inspections
- Preparing detailed inspection reports using inspection software
- Taking explicit and accurate property photographs and videos
- Identifying maintenance items and reporting findings to the Property Management team
- Scheduling routine inspections and coordinating appointments
- Conducting Property Condition Reports (PCRs), including detailed written reports and photography (adhoc when required)
- Liaising with landlords, tenants and contractors in a professional manner
- Collecting and returning keys as required
- Maintaining accurate records and ensuring compliance with company procedures
